WhatsApp users switching account to new phone will be asked to verify move on old device


WhatsApp has announced some new security features. — Photo by Dimitri Karastelev on Unsplash

WhatsApp has announced its latest security feature, where users switching their account to a new device will be asked to verify the move on the old device.

The company said this feature, called Account Protect, will help to alert users of any unauthorised attempt to move their account to another device. The prompt will ask users to “Allow moving your WhatsApp account to another device” with details namely time and device type being used.
